Pros
Health insurance is cheap and now that they have a decent network we have actual doctors to pick from versus the zero before. Relatively flexible scheduling as long as you don't request time off the week before or of a holiday. Everything else is a con.
Cons
Abysmal allocation of hours to do the job. Job takes 16 hours you will get 8 because the multibillion dollar corporation cant afford to give you the proper amount of time to do the job. Tasks are added every period and hours allocated to do the tasks are reduced because of "efficiency improvements." Expectations are for everything to be flawless from open to close. You spend half your shift taking pictures of your department and store as proof that workers did something. The hourly pay is absolutely horrendous given the expectations the company has. My hourly pay barely covers expenses to rent a one bedroom apartment. The second you stop moving an alarm goes off and a manager shows up in your department to point out everything wrong and wonders why you aren't moving. Raises are never more than 25¢/hr/year.
